متطلبات النظام
لا يتطلب Aspose.Words for Python via .NET تثبيت أي منتج تابع لجهة خارجية مثل Microsoft Word. يعد Aspose.Words بحد ذاته محركًا لإنشاء المستندات وتعديلها وتحويلها وعرضها بتنسيقات مختلفة، بما في ذلك تنسيقات مستندات Microsoft Word.
أنظمة التشغيل المدعومة
يدعم Aspose.Words for Python via .NET أي نظام تشغيل 64 بت أو 32 بت حيث تم تثبيت Python 3.5 أو الأحدث.
نظام التشغيل | الإصدارات |
Microsoft Windows |
|
ماك |
|
Linux |
|
متطلبات النظام لمنصات Target Linux وmacOS
-
مكتبات وقت التشغيل دول مجلس التعاون الخليجي-6 (أو الأحدث).
-
تبعيات .NET Core Runtime. يتطلب تثبيت .NET Core Runtime نفسه
NOT
. -
بالنسبة إلى Python 3.5-3.7: يلزم إنشاء
pymalloc
لـ Python. يتم تمكين خيار إنشاء--with-pymalloc
Python افتراضيًا. عادةً، يتم تمييز بنيةpymalloc
لـ Python بلاحقةm
في اسم الملف. -
مكتبة Python المشتركة
libpython
. يتم تعطيل خيار إنشاء--enable-shared
Python بشكل افتراضي، ولا تحتوي بعض توزيعات Python على مكتبةlibpython
المشتركة. بالنسبة لبعض منصات Linux، يمكن تثبيت مكتبةlibpython
المشتركة باستخدام مدير الحزم، على سبيل المثال:sudo apt-get install libpython3.7
. المشكلة الشائعة هي أن مكتبةlibpython
مثبتة في موقع مختلف عن موقع النظام القياسي للمكتبات المشتركة. يمكن إصلاح المشكلة باستخدام خيارات إنشاء Python لتعيين مسارات مكتبة بديلة عند تجميع Python، أو إصلاحها عن طريق إنشاء رابط رمزي لملف مكتبةlibpython
في الموقع القياسي للنظام للمكتبات المشتركة. عادةً ما يكون اسم ملف المكتبة المشتركةlibpython
هوlibpythonX.Ym.so.1.0
لـ Python 3.5-3.7، أوlibpythonX.Y.so.1.0
لـ Python 3.8 أو الأحدث (على سبيل المثال: libpython3.7m.so.1.0، libpython3.9.so.1.0)